A main consideration in appraising is to determine a property’s value: the present worth of future benefitsarising from the ownership of real property. Unlike many consumer goods such as oil, lumber, food, etc. that are quickly used, the benefits of real property are generally realized over a long period of time. Therefore, an estimate of a property’s value must take into consideration economic and social factors, as well as governmental controls or regulations and environmental conditions that may influence the four elements of value:
- Demand – the desire or need for ownership supported by the financial means to satisfy the desire;
- Utility – the ability to satisfy future owners’ desires and needs;
- Scarcity – the finite supply of competing properties
- Transfer-ability – the ease with which ownership rights are transferred.
